Output 5665d8daf52c90e3cca766142556a1b55cf6b77df28d578c0b98e5a6b04e97c7:10

value
5804087
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b037a9a52bd0ade335d785eb33b747dcc88f3842 OP_EQUAL
address
3HkmXpJt9yjv5rE6HsRJsE9CKqsGF5WqcT
transaction
5665d8daf52c90e3cca766142556a1b55cf6b77df28d578c0b98e5a6b04e97c7
spent
true